Flowering earlier than most varieties, Agapanthus Ever Sapphire (African Lily) is a dwarf, clump-forming, evergreen herbaceous perennial boasting loose clusters of deep blue flowers over a long season. Starting flowering in late spring, it reblooms throughout the summer for a long-lasting display. The ravishing blossoms sit atop slender stalks that arise from a lush clump of strap-shaped, fresh green leaves. This compact Agapanthus is very suitable for perennial borders or container planting on the balcony, terrace, or patio.
